Our top Charleston rental property booking tips:
Finding the best value:
- To get the best value, try shifting your family's Charleston area vacation week to the Spring or Fall shoulder seasons. May, September, and October offer warmer temperatures, less crowded beaches, and re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to book an oceanfront vacation rental that would otherwise be unavailable during the Summer months.
- The sooner you can reserve a home, the easier your search will be. The best vacation rentals are booked early. Reserving your vacation rental up to tw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to plan and reserve your vacation home.
-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property manager or host whether your family qualifies for a price reduction or discount.
- Management companies and individual rental owners usually offer guests an option to buy trip insurance. Trip insurance, which generally will cost you an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ed vacation time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unexpected hotel or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your host for more information.
- Find a copy of your local visitors guide when you check-in. If your rental do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great articles, visitors guides have money saving offers on nearby tours, shops, and attractions.
Selecting the best rental home:
- Choose a designated group leader, choose your dates, and choose a maximum budget.
- Decide how many bedrooms and the bed configuration you need. Liberty Place Charleston, a Hilton Club - 1 Bedroom Plus has 1 bedrooms and 1 bathrooms. If you need a larger or smaller rental, use our rental home search.
- Precise descriptions of bedrooms and bed sizes & counts is commonly available on booking pages. If you don't see them listed, call the property owner before reserving the property. Note that most listings specify the max. guest capacity, which typically includes pull out couches in living rooms. You'll need to determine which bed configuration is suitable for your family.
- Are you looking for unique amenities? Most rental websites include search filters for amenities. Use these to your advantage to find the perfect rental home.
- Appropriate accessibility amenities can make or ruin a vacation for guests that require the use of a wheelchair. Confirm all necessary amenities are available and included before reserving a rental.
- If your family is bringing pets, you must book a property that allows animals. Make sure to ask for information on breed, size, and type restrictions. Note that some property managers charge pet deposits and fees.
